Many drivers still mistakenly believe that in order to legally drive a vehicle, it is necessary to have a printed form. In fact, since 2017 electronic insurance policy equal to its paper counterpart and has full legal force throughout the Russian Federation. Traffic police inspectors have access to a single database where they can see the insurance status of a particular vehicle in real time.

However, having the file on your smartphone or tablet greatly simplifies the verification procedure. You can simply show the device screen to a traffic police officer, and he will read the QR code or visually verify the data. If the gadget is discharged and there is no paper copy, the inspector can check the car using the database, but this will take more time and will require special equipment or communication with the duty unit.

⚠️ Attention: Printing out the electronic policy is not required by law, but is highly desirable. In areas of poor mobile network signal or in case of failures in the traffic police database, having a physical copy or file in the phone’s memory will save you from long waits and possible disputes.

It is important to understand that the data in the database RSA are not updated instantly. Between the moment of paying for the policy on the insurance company’s website and the appearance of information in the general database, it can take from several minutes to several hours. Therefore, immediately after purchase, it is better not to take risks and wait for confirmation that the system has “seen” your contract.

Search for a policy through the official RSA website

The most reliable and universal way to find information about current insurance is to use the service on the website of the Russian Union of Auto Insurers. This resource aggregates data from all insurance companies operating in the MTPL system, which makes it an indispensable tool for verification. You don't have to guess which company you took out insurance with last year or signed up for a policy online.

To search, you will need to enter vehicle details. The system allows you to search by VIN code, body or chassis number, as well as state registration plate. Enter the data carefully, as the system is sensitive to errors and extra spaces. This is especially true for the VIN code, where it is easy to confuse numbers and letters.

After entering the data and passing the captcha, the system will display a table with information. It will indicate the name of the insurance company, series and number of the policy, as well as the start and end dates of its validity. If the policy is valid, you will see its status. If the system writes that the contract was not found, this may mean that the insurance has not yet been entered into the database, it has already expired, or the data was entered incorrectly.

  • 🚗 Go to the official RSA website in the “Checking OSAGO policies” section.
  • 🔢 Select the search type: by VIN code (most accurate) or by license plate number.
  • ✅ Enter the requested data in the appropriate fields of the form.
  • 📅 Check the results received: series, number and validity period of the contract.

It is worth noting that the RSA website only shows the existence of an agreement and its main parameters. As a rule, you cannot download the policy form itself with logos and signatures through this service - it serves specifically to check and obtain contract details. These details (number and series) will be the key to restoring the complete document.

Restoration through the personal account of the insurance company

If you know which insurance company you registered with electronic MTPL, the fastest way would be to contact their official resource. All major insurers provide clients with access to a personal account, where the history of all purchases and existing contracts is stored. Even if you have lost the letter with the policy, it remains in your profile forever.

To enter your personal account, you will need the login and password that you created when registering on the site. If you have forgotten your login details, use the access recovery feature, which usually requires confirmation via an SMS code sent to the linked phone number or via email. This is standard security procedure.

After authorization, find the section called “My Policies”, “Contracts” or “Purchase History”. A list of all insurances you have taken out will be displayed there. Select the current contract and click the “Download” button or the printer icon. The file will download in PDF format, and you can send it again to your email or save it to your phone.

In some cases, especially when changing your last name or passport data, access to your old account may be limited. In such a situation, you may need to call the insurance company's contact center to verify your identity. The operator will be able to dictate the policy number or send a download link after confirming your data.

Search by email and SMS messages

We often look for complex ways to solve a problem, forgetting about the most obvious ones. Upon purchase electronic policy The insurance company is obliged to send the document to the email specified during registration. This letter is legally binding and contains the policy file itself, as well as a receipt for payment. Searching your mailbox is one of the easiest recovery methods.

Open your mailbox that you specified when purchasing insurance. In the search bar, enter the keywords: “OSAGO”, “policy”, “insurance” or the name of the proposed insurance company (for example, “Ingosstrakh”, “Alfa”, “Rosgosstrakh”). Be sure to also check your Spam folder, as automated mailings sometimes end up there.

If you do not find the letter at your main mail, check the alternative mailboxes you use. Often, when registering through aggregators or comparing prices, users indicate a secondary email. It is also worth checking the SMS history on your phone: many companies send a short message with the policy number and a link to download it immediately after payment.

Actions in case of loss of data about the insurer

The situation when a driver does not remember where exactly he was insured occurs quite often, especially if the policy was issued through intermediaries or aggregators. In this case, the algorithm of actions must be strictly sequential so as not to waste time going through all possible options.

The first step should always be to search the database RSA via the vehicle's VIN code. As mentioned earlier, this method will show you the exact name of the insurance company. Knowing the insurer's brand, you can already narrow your search and can go to their official website to restore access through your personal account.

If a search in the PCA database does not produce results, although you are sure that the insurance is valid, the data may not have been updated yet. In this case, try to remember through which service you paid for the policy. Check your transaction history in online banking (Sberbank Online, Tinkoff, etc.) or in electronic wallets. The transaction description often includes the name of the payee, which is the same as the name of the insurance company or its partner.

  • 🔍 Use the RSA database to identify the insurer by VIN code.
  • 🏦 Check your payment history in your banking app for the purchase period.
  • 📞 Call the contact center of the identified insurance company.
  • 📧 Check your email for letters from insurance aggregators.

⚠️ Attention: Beware of scammers! If you are looking for a policy on third-party sites that promise to “break the base” for money, there is a high probability of losing money. All official checks through RSA are free. Do not enter card details on suspicious resources.

As a last resort, if there are no traces left and time is running out, it is easier and faster to issue a new policy. The old contract, if there was one, will be automatically closed or canceled when the coefficients are recalculated, although formally it is better to inform the insurer about the loss of data. However, double insurance of one car for the same period is impossible; the system simply will not allow you to pay for the second policy if the first one is active.

A common problem is data inconsistency. If, when checking, you see your policy, but the information about the owner or car differs from reality (for example, an error in one VIN digit), such a policy is considered invalid. In this case, you need to urgently contact the insurance company to make adjustments, otherwise in the event of an accident you may be denied payment, and the traffic police may issue a fine.

It's also worth keeping deadlines in mind. The electronic policy begins to be valid only the next day after payment (unless you specified a later start date). If you bought insurance today, and tomorrow you are stopped, it will already be in the database, but formally the validity period has not yet arrived, unless “tomorrow” is selected. Be careful when choosing the start date of the contract.

Is it possible to show the policy to the inspector as a photo in the phone gallery?

Yes, the legislation of the Russian Federation allows the demonstration of an electronic policy from the screen of a smartphone, tablet or laptop. A photo in a gallery, a screenshot or an open PDF file are equally valid. The main thing is that the QR code and text are read clearly, and the data matches the data on the driver’s license and STS.

What to do if there is a policy in the RSA database, but it is not on the insurance website?

This is a common technical desynchronization. Data in the unified RSA database has priority, since this is what traffic police inspectors turn to. If the policy is displayed in the RCA database as valid, then it is valid. The lack of a copy in your personal account on the insurance website is a problem with their interface, which needs to be resolved through the company’s technical support.

Is it necessary to certify an electronic policy with a seal from the insurer?

No, additional certification with the seal or signature of an insurance company employee is not required. The electronic signature, which is already embedded in the PDF file of the policy when it is generated, is a complete legal analogue of a handwritten signature and seal. Any demands to print and certify a document are illegal.
